North Carolina GOP invoice would weaken incoming Democratic leaders

North Carolina Republicans superior intensive laws Tuesday that might weaken the powers of the incoming governor, legal professional normal and faculties superintendent — all Democrats who had been elected two weeks in the past — and shift election board appointments to the GOP state auditor.

The ultimate 131-page measure, which additionally contains setting apart further funds for Hurricane Helene aid, turned public roughly an hour earlier than the GOP-controlled Home met to debate it throughout a lame-duck Normal Meeting session this week. The Home voted largely alongside social gathering strains Tuesday evening for the measure, which the Republican-controlled Senate was anticipated to take up on Wednesday.

With Republicans prone to lose their veto-proof majority within the subsequent two-year session following electoral losses within the Home, this week could possibly be the final finest likelihood for them to enact laws containing sharp partisan modifications. Democratic Gov. Roy Cooper leaves workplace at 12 months’s finish and will probably be succeeded by Democrat Josh Stein.

Presently the State Board of Elections’ 5 members are appointed by the governor primarily based on suggestions by the Democratic and Republican events. The governor’s social gathering at all times holds three of the seats. Republican legislators have tried for years to wrest away these appointment powers however have been thwarted by courts. Judges have blocked for now a 2023 legislation that might transfer board appointment authority from the governor to the Normal Meeting.

Even with litigation pending, Tuesday’s measure would transfer the unbiased state board to the State Auditor’s Workplace beginning subsequent summer season. At the moment the brand new auditor — Republican Dave Boliek, who was elected this month — would make appointments. These modifications doubtless would imply Republican management of the board.

In a possible response to complaints about gradual vote-counting this month, the invoice additionally would require in 2025 that county election boards depend all provisional ballots by three days after Election Day.

Some counties didn’t full this 12 months’s provisional poll depend till days after final Friday’s canvassing date. The measure additionally would transfer up the deadline by which some individuals who lack a photograph identification card whereas voting should present they’ve one for his or her poll to depend.

GOP Rep. Gray Mills, a Home elections committee chairman, mentioned the state auditor is the very best place to deal with the elections board, provided that the put up is thought for conducting investigations and opinions. And the election counting modifications will create extra effectivity.

“Our voters expect us to be able to provide the election results in a timely fashion,” Mills mentioned. “I truly believe that this language will do this.”

State Board of Elections Govt Director Karen Brinson Bell mentioned that board workers weren’t consulted concerning the laws and it “may make it impossible for the county boards of elections to adequately ensure every eligible ballot cast is counted, especially in high turnout elections.”

Tuesday’s invoice comprises further Helene-related provisions and locates an extra $227 million from the state’s reserves however orders the cash to stay unspent for now. It does give $50 million extra to assist Cooper’s administration handle a shortfall to finish housing initiatives nonetheless left over from Hurricane Matthew in 2016 and Hurricane Florence in 2018.

State lawmakers beforehand put aside over $900 million towards Helene aid and restoration in two measures permitted this fall and signed by Cooper. Cooper has requested for legislators to supply rather more, and shortly.

Democrats from western North Carolina mentioned Republicans had been extra all for energy grabs than serving to companies and residents broken by Helene. Republicans used a process by which Democrats couldn’t supply amendments.

“This bill makes it pretty clear that the body is prioritizing political priorities over the very real need for rapid assistance in the western part of our state,” Buncombe County Rep. Eric Ager mentioned. Three Republicans from the west ended up voting no on the invoice — a growth that would scuttle a possible Cooper override.

Rep. Donny Lambeth, a Forsyth County Republican who solely dealt with the spending provisions, mentioned lawmakers are receiving Helene spending requests each day.


Republican state Rep. Donny Lambeth

“There’s a lot of work still that needs to be done … and still, quite frankly, a lot of money that’s going to have to be spent,” Lambeth mentioned.

The laws additionally would instantly weaken the governor’s authority to fill vacancies on the state Court docket of Appeals and Supreme Court docket by limiting selections to 3 candidates provided by the political social gathering of the outgoing justice or choose.

Stein, who’s at present legal professional normal, is being succeeded by fellow Democrat Jeff Jackson. The invoice would restrict the legal professional normal partially by barring him in litigation that challenges a legislation’s validity from taking authorized positions opposite to the Normal Meeting. Stein has not too long ago declined to defend in courtroom parts of legal guidelines that prohibit surgical abortions and abortion capsules.

“Instead of stepping up, the Republicans in the General Assembly are grabbing power and exacting political retribution,” Stein mentioned Tuesday on the social platform X.

And the invoice additionally will forestall the superintendent of public instruction — a put up that’s switching social gathering management in January, to Democrat Mo Inexperienced — would now be barred from interesting choices by a state board that opinions constitution faculty purposes.

The Republican try and erode Democrats’ powers remembers related measures handed in late 2016 that had been designed to weaken Cooper, who was about to succeed Republican Gov. Pat McCrory. These payments led to loud demonstrations within the Legislative Constructing and dozens of arrests.
